>#4 -- Learn to give up, cut your losses, be gracious in defeat. What value does Microsoft get from IE? Really?
Well.. They get to add OS specific features like sharing the rendering engine and client http stack to all applications on windows who want to use it. They can enhance browser security using OS mechanisms like IE on Vista's Protected Mode. They also won't abandon tons of paying customers that have developed web applications that just don't work with firefox because firefox cares (for the better or the worse) more about standards compliance then backwards compatability.
